Award-Winning Social Psychologist on What High-Performing Teams Do Differently and How AI Is Changing Collaboration

Published 2 days, 16 hours ago
Description

I talk with Ron Friedman, award-winning social psychologist and bestselling author of The Best Place to Work and Super Teams, about what high-performing teams actually do differently. We get into why great teams avoid unnecessary meetings, how teammates make each other better, why feedback usually fails, and how AI is changing collaboration, curiosity, communication, and accountability at work.
